Is there a dedicated “Pixlr background remover” button?
Product naming varies by version; look for remove-background, cutout, or use selection plus erase. The capability is the same: a clean mask and transparent export.
Will my PNG be huge?
Tall high-resolution exports grow quickly—crop to the subject and resize for the destination (shop listing vs print) before sharing.
